James Royall wrote:

>But how do I work out depth of field using the scale on the lens? Using 
>the 24mm (which becomes a 'standard' 48mm) on an OM at F8 gives an 
>indicated depth of field of just over a meter to infinity. Can I do 
>something simple, like looking at the DOF for F4 when used with a 4/3 
>sensor? Or do I have to take along my 50mm and see what DOF that would 
>give me on an OM at F8? Or am I going to have to have to take some 
>chalk, draw a huge 30 meter ruler on the street outside and work out my 
>own scale?
>  
>
I suspect the most practical way to start would be to compare the DOF 
tables for one of the E-1 lenses against the 35mm based DOF table for 
the 24mm (which you can find on the eSIF). Unfortunately, the 
instruction manual for the 14-54 lens on Oly's web site doesn't include 
an DOF tables.

Anybody know wher one can find DOF tables for E-1 lenses? Even if the 
focal lengths aren't exact matches, one could at least discover the CoLC 
they are using.
